The Manual Handling Operations Regulations 1992, as amended, set out a clear hierarchy rather than a fixed rulebook: avoid hazardous manual handling so far as is reasonably practicable; where it cannot be avoided, assess the risk of any that remains; and reduce that risk so far as is reasonably practicable. HSE's own guidance on the regulations, L23, is explicit that there is no specific weight limit in the regulations themselves -- weight is one factor among several, and a load that's perfectly manageable for one task, one person or one environment can be genuinely hazardous in another.
A proper manual handling assessment looks at more than the object being moved. HSE's guidance uses the shorthand TILEO to structure this: the Task itself (twisting, stooping, repetitive movement, distance carried); the Individual doing it (their capability, any health condition, whether they've been trained for this specific task); the Load (weight, but also size, shape, whether it's stable, whether it has good hand-holds); the Environment (uneven flooring, restricted space, poor lighting, steps); and Other factors (personal protective equipment that restricts movement, or handling aids that aren't actually available on site). HSE also publishes specific tools for this -- the MAC tool for lifting, carrying and team handling, RAPP for pushing and pulling, and ART for repetitive tasks -- which a competent contractor should be using rather than an informal judgement call.
Property maintenance and refurbishment work in an occupied care home routinely involves manual handling in conditions the regulations were specifically written to flag as higher risk: awkward access through narrow corridors and doorways designed for wheelchairs rather than materials trolleys, work carried out around furniture and residents rather than a clear site, and materials that have to be carried further than a straight run from a van to a work area because vehicle access is restricted. A generic manual handling policy that doesn't account for the actual access route on a specific job is unlikely to count as a suitable and sufficient assessment if it's ever tested.
Where a load cannot reasonably be avoided, the regulations expect the risk to be reduced before it's accepted as unavoidable -- breaking a heavy or awkward item into smaller units, using two people for a load one person could technically move but shouldn't, or using a mechanical aid such as a sash cramp, trolley or hoist. Using a mechanical aid reduces the manual handling risk but doesn't eliminate the regulations' relevance entirely -- human effort is still involved in controlling the aid, so the assessment should still cover how it's actually used, not just note that one exists.
The regulations place the duty on the employer, but in practice the person best placed to spot a genuinely hazardous manual handling situation on a specific day is often the site supervisor or the contractor actually doing the work, since access conditions and loads change from job to job in a way a generic risk assessment written in an office cannot fully anticipate. A working method that expects operatives to flag a manual handling problem as it's encountered, not just follow a pre-written assessment regardless of what they actually find on site, is a genuine part of complying with the regulations, not a gap in them.
